Composition:
MEBENDAZOLE-100MG
Uses:
Parasitic worm infections.
Medicinal Benefits:
Kit-Kat Syrup belongs to a group of anthelmintic medicines used to treat worm infections such as pinworm, whipworm, roundworm, hookworm, and other parasites. Kit-Kat Syrup contains ‘Mebendazole’, which works by inhibiting tubulin polymerization. This causes metabolic disruption and energy depletion in the parasite, which leads to its immobilization. Thereby, Kit-Kat Syrup kills the susceptible helminth and treats the infection.

Regular monitoring of blood count at the beginning of each cycle therapy and for every 2weeks while taking Kit-Kat Syrup is advised for all patients. Treatment with Kit-Kat Syrup should be discontinued if a significant decrease in blood cell count is observed.
Kit-Kat Syrup might increase the chances of getting an infection. Maintain proper hygiene and try to stay away from people with infections, flu or cold.
Do not discontinue Kit-Kat Syrup without consulting your doctor. To treat your condition effectually continue taking Kit-Kat Syrup for as long as prescribed. Do not be reluctant to speak with your doctor if you feel any difficulty while taking Kit-Kat Syrup.
Take the missed dose of Kit-Kat Syrup as soon as possible. However, if it is time for the next dose, skip the missed dose and return to your regular dosing schedule. Do not double the dose.
